About the company

PT Eterindo Wahanatama Tbk produces and sells biodiesel in Indonesia and internationally. It also trades in chemical products; and engages in oil palm plantation and derivative product business. PT Eterindo Wahanatama Tbk was founded in 1992 and is based in Jakarta, Indonesia. PT Eterindo Wahanatama Tbk operates as a subsidiary of Pt Mordred Investama Indonesia.

How we calculate Fair Value

Each company is valued through a stack of independent intrinsic-value models (DCF variants, residual-income, multiples and more), blended into one family-balanced consensus and weighted by how much trustworthy data backs it. A separate quality layer scores the fundamentals. Every input is real reported data — nothing guessed.
